say-me

This npm module say you what programs or npm modules installed on current machine.

Install

Install as local module
npm i say-me
npm i --save say-me
npm i -D say-me
Install as global module
npm i -g say-me

Using in JS code

Include module and create object
var SayMe = require('say-me');
var sayMe = new SayMe();

or

var sayMe = require('say-me/create');
Program is installed
var programName = 'npm';
var res = sayMe.programIsInstalled(programName);
console.log(res);
console.log(sayMe.programList);

true [ { name: 'npm', isInstall: true } ]

Programs is installed
var programList = [
  'git',
  'npm',
  'say-me',
  'test-module',
  'jasmine',
  'shelljs'
];
var res = sayMe.programsIsInstalled(programList);
console.log(res);
console.log(sayMe.programList);

false [ { name: 'git', isInstall: true }, { name: 'npm', isInstall: true }, { name: 'say-me', isInstall: true }, { name: 'test-module', isInstall: false }, { name: 'jasmine', isInstall: true }, { name: 'shelljs', isInstall: false } ]

Npm module is installed
var moduleName = 'shelljs';
var res = sayMe.npmModuleIsInstalled(moduleName);
console.log(res);
console.log(sayMe.programList);

true [ { name: 'shelljs', isInstall: true } ]

Npm modules is installed
var moduleArr = [
  'git',
  'npm',
  'say-me',
  'test-module',
  'jasmine',
  'shelljs'
];
var res = sayMe.npmModulesIsInstalled(moduleArr);
console.log(res);
console.log(sayMe.programList);

false [ { name: 'git', isInstall: false }, { name: 'npm', isInstall: false }, { name: 'say-me', isInstall: false }, { name: 'test-module', isInstall: false }, { name: 'jasmine', isInstall: true }, { name: 'shelljs', isInstall: true } ]

Npm module is installed with global flag
sayMe.isGlobal = true;
moduleArr = [
  'npm',
  'jasmine'
];
var res = sayMe.npmModulesIsInstalled(moduleArr);
console.log(res);
console.log(sayMe.programList);

true [ { name: 'npm', isInstall: true }, { name: 'jasmine', isInstall: true } ]

Returns all installed npm modules
res = sayMe.getAllNpmModules();
console.log(res);

[ { version: '0.6.1', from: 'optimist@>=0.6.1 <0.7.0', resolved: 'https://registry.npmjs.org/optimist/-/optimist-0.6.1.tgz', name: 'optimist' }, ...]

Using in console

Need install say-me module as global module

say-me
say-me --pii -p git
say-me --psii git node npm
say-me --npmmii -p say-me
say-me --npmmsii say-me jasmine
say-me --npmmsii -g say-me jasmine
